Product Overview
Product Name | Recombinant Human Putative TGFB1-induced anti-apoptotic factor 1 (TIAF1/MYO18A) Protein |
Product Overview | This recombinant human Putative TGFB1-induced anti-apoptotic factor 1 (TIAF1/MYO18A) protein includes amino acids 1-115aa of the target gene is expressed in E.coli.The protein is supplied in lyophilized form and formulated in phosphate buffered saline (pH7.4) containing 0.01% sarcosyl, 5% trehaloseprior to lyophilization. |
Target Uniprot Id | O95411 |
Recommended Name | Putative TGFB1-induced anti-apoptotic factor 1 |
Gene Name | MYO18A |
Synonyms | TGFB1-induced anti-apoptotic factor 1, MAJN, SPR210 |
Species | Human |
Predicted Molecular Mass | 16.6 kDa |
Expression System | E.coli |
Expression Range | 1-115aa |
Tag | N-6His |
Purity | >90% |
Formulation | Lyophilized |
Buffer | Phosphate buffered saline (pH7.4) containing 0.01% sarcosyl, 5%Trehalose |
Storage Condition | 1. Store at -20°C/-80°C upon receipt, aliquoting is necessary for mutiple use. 2. Av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les. 3. Store working aliquots at 4°C for up to one week. 4. In general, protein in liquid form is stable for up to 6 months at -20°C/-80°C. Protein in lyophilized powder form is stable for up to 12 months at -20°C/-80°C. |
Reconstitution Instruction | Briefly centrifuged the vial prior to opening to bring the contents to the bottom. Reconstitute protein in deionized sterile water to a concentration of 0.1-1.0 mg/mL. It is recommended to add 5-50% of glycerol (final concentration) and aliquot for long-term storage at -20°C/-80°C. The default final concentration of glycerol is 50%. |
Applications | Positive Control; Immunogen; SDS-PAGE; WB |
Research Area | Cell Biology |
Target Function | Inhibits the cytotoxic effects of TNF-alpha and overexpressed TNF receptor adapters TRADD, FADD, and RIPK1. Involved in TGF-beta1 inhibition of IkappaB-alpha expression and suppression of TNF-mediated IkappaB-alpha degradation. |
Subcellular Location | Nucleus. |
Tissue Specificity | Not detectable in normal kidney and liver. Up-regulated in chronic and acute allograft rejection: expressed in the inflammatory infiltrate and in tubular epithelial cells. |
